Yellow Mustard Powder A Grade Premium Quality Ground Mustard Powder Natural Seasoning Mustard powder is a versatile spice derived from ground mustard seeds. Known for its pungent and zesty flavor, mustard powder is a popular ingredient in various cuisines around the world. Let's explore the characteristics, common uses, and tips for incorporating Mustard Powder into your culinary creations in simple and everyday language. Characteristics of Mustard Powder: Ground Mustard Seeds: Mustard powder is made by grinding mustard seeds, resulting in a fine powder with a distinct yellow color. Pungent Flavor: It possesses a pungent and tangy flavor that adds a bold kick to dishes. Common Uses in Everyday Life: Condiment Base: Mustard powder serves as the base for making mustard condiments. When mixed with water, vinegar, or other liquids, it transforms into a spreadable mustard. Flavor Enhancer: Used in various recipes to enhance the flavor of sauces, dressings, marinades, and pickles. Cooking and Baking: Adds depth to meat rubs, curries, stews, and baked goods, providing a unique and zesty taste. Tips for Using Mustard Powder: Gradual Addition: Start with a small amount of Mustard Powder and adjust according to your taste preferences. It can be potent, so a little goes a long way. Experimentation: Explore different cuisines and recipes to discover the versatility of Mustard Powder. It pairs well with a variety of ingredients. Storage: Keep Mustard Powder in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to preserve its flavor. You may not realize it, but did you know that mustard seeds actually come from the vegetable mustard greens? Most people simply enjoy mustard greens as a leafy vegetable, but, if left to flower and go to seeds, you'll get mustard seeds! Mustard seeds can be used in a number of different ways including as a spice, or made into actual mustard paste.
